About this clipart
The image depicts a man in late 18th-century attire-a navy blue coat, cream waistcoat, white breeches, black tricorn hat, and red saddlecloth-mounted on a spirited chestnut horse mid-gallop. His right arm is extended, index finger pointing forward with urgency, suggesting he’s delivering critical news or leading a charge; dust kicks up beneath the horse’s hooves, emphasizing motion and immediacy.
This illustration is commonly used in educational resources about the American Revolution, historical reenactment websites, museum exhibits, or textbooks to visualize messengers, officers, or pivotal moments like Paul Revere’s ride. It serves users seeking visual context for colonial military or civic life.
